巧用VPS服务器修复商城网站支付失败报错
文章分类:技术文档 /
创建时间:2026-01-02
电商时代,商城网站的支付流畅度不仅关乎用户体验,更直接影响实际营收。当使用VPS服务器部署商城网站时,若遭遇支付失败报错,掌握科学的排查方法能快速恢复交易链路。
现象:支付失败的三类典型表现
使用VPS服务器部署的商城网站,支付失败的报错形式可归为三类。第一类是明确提示类,如“支付渠道连接异常”直接指向网站与支付网关的通信问题;“支付签名验证失败”则表明安全验证环节出现偏差。第二类是页面异常类,用户点击支付后页面卡顿、无响应,或未跳转至支付结果页直接返回原页面,这类问题无明确报错信息,排查难度较高。第三类是偶发失败类,部分用户支付成功但部分失败,可能与服务器资源分配或网络波动相关。
诊断:支付失败的三大核心诱因
网络稳定性是首要排查点。VPS服务器若因带宽不足、网络中断或遭受DDoS攻击(分布式拒绝服务攻击),会导致支付请求无法及时传输至支付网关,或支付结果反馈延迟。例如,服务器带宽被攻击流量占满时,正常支付请求会被挤压甚至丢弃。
支付配置错误是常见软件问题。若在VPS服务器上配置支付插件时填写了错误的商户ID、密钥或回调地址,支付系统无法完成身份验证与数据匹配,自然会拒绝交易。这类问题多因人工操作失误或版本更新后配置未同步导致。
安全软件误拦截不可忽视。服务器安装的防火墙、入侵检测系统若规则设置过严,可能将支付请求的特定端口、协议识别为恶意攻击,从而拦截支付相关的HTTP/HTTPS流量。这种情况常发生在安全策略更新或新软件安装后。
解决:分场景针对性修复方案
针对网络问题,首先登录VPS服务器管理后台检查实时带宽使用率与连接状态,确认是否存在异常流量。若带宽不足可升级网络套餐,若检测到攻击需启用DDoS防护功能,部分服务商提供的弹性防护能自动识别并清洗恶意流量。
支付配置排查需逐项核对。进入商城后台支付插件设置页,对照支付平台提供的API文档,重新确认商户ID、密钥、支付回调URL等参数。若配置无误但仍报错,可联系支付平台技术支持获取日志分析,排查是否存在接口版本不兼容问题。
安全软件误拦截的解决方法是临时关闭防护工具测试。关闭防火墙或入侵检测系统后重新发起支付,若成功则说明是安全策略问题。此时需在防护软件中添加白名单,允许支付网关IP、特定端口(如443)及交易相关的URL路径通过,平衡安全与支付流畅性。
通过对支付报错现象的精准识别、诱因的分层诊断及针对性修复,使用VPS服务器部署的商城网站能快速恢复支付功能,确保用户交易体验与业务营收稳定。
工信部备案:苏ICP备2025168537号-1